The Type 1 Diabetes Score in 50529, Dakota City, Iowa is 84 out of 100 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.

91.79 percent of the population in 50529 drive to work alone. 0.00 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 83.58 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 1.24 percent of the residents in 50529 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 2.38 members with about 2.24 cars available per household.

An estimate of 93.65 percent of the residents in 50529 has some form of health insurance. 38.54 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 70.29 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.

A resident in 50529 would have to travel an average of 1.65 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Humboldt County Memorial Hospital . In a 20-mile radius, there are 0 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 50529, Dakota City, Iowa.

As of , an estimate of 929 residents live in 50529 with a median age of 38.5 years. 31.22 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 15.07 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 36.95 percent of the residents in 50529 is currently married, and 21.44 percent of the population has never been married.

The monthly median household income in 50529 is $6,388.92.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 50529 is approximately $655. The median household spends about 10.25 percent of their income on housing.

For individuals with Type 1 Diabetes, access to quality healthcare is crucial for managing their condition effectively. Type 1 Diabetes is a chronic condition in which the pancreas produces little or no insulin, requiring individuals to regularly monitor their blood sugar levels and administer insulin as needed. This necessitates regular visits to healthcare providers for check-ups, blood tests, and prescription refills.

Missing these appointments can have serious health implications for individuals with Type 1 Diabetes and can also result in increased financial costs due to emergency care or complications from unmanaged diabetes. Therefore, having convenient access to healthcare providers is essential for individuals with Type 1 Diabetes.
